"CHANEL" 96's Spring collection tuck pleats shirt
We would like to introduce you to some beautifully crafted masterpieces from CHANEL, a brand that has brought about changes in women's clothing, values, and lifestyles with its many innovative designs, and that remains a coveted brand among women even now, more than 100 years after its founding.
The dress features elegant tuxedo pleats on the chest.

This piece is a clear expression of the approach that Chanel excelled at in the mid-90s, which was to incorporate elements of men's formal wear into light, everyday wear.
The front features fine pleats at equal intervals on a rounded, fly-front panel, creating a subtle three-dimensional effect and shadows only around the chest. The amount of pleats is kept to a minimum, calculated to avoid excessive decoration, so while maintaining the tension of a formal shirt, it also has an air of ease that makes it easy to wear in everyday life, which is its charm.
The collar is a slightly long, sharp pointed collar, which gives the neck a clean look while still having a good presence when peeking out from under a jacket.
The sleeves feature deep cuffs with two buttonholes placed side by side, allowing them to be worn as single cuffs or with cufflinks for a double cuff look. The buttons are made of high-quality shell engraved with the CHANEL BOUTIQUE logo, and the subtle iridescent sheen that appears depending on the light adds a quiet elegance to the entire white shirt.
The body of the dress is designed with a straight silhouette that does not constrict the waist excessively, and the fabric falls slightly away from the body, allowing the hem to sway softly with every movement, creating an elegant and relaxed look.
The material used is cotton poplin, which has just the right amount of firmness and flexibility. The firmness of the pleated parts allows them to maintain their three-dimensional shape, while the entire body will gradually conform to your body with repeated wear, making it a texture that you'll want to wear for a long time.
Considering the historical context of the 1996 Spring Collection, a time when Chanel was reconstructing its signature classic elements within a minimalist and clean mood, this shirt also started out as "masculine formal wear" but has been perfected as a modern, gender-neutral shirt, which is a major added value.
In terms of styling, it pairs well with a tailored jacket and simple slacks, opting for no tie or necktie, so that the pleats on the chest are just decorative, or tucked into a long skirt or loose wide-leg pants for a monochrome look that makes the shirt the focal point. By leaving the buttons slightly open and casually rolling up the sleeves, you can enjoy a relaxed shirt style that blends naturally into your everyday life, while still retaining its formal details.
